JAKARTA, KOMPAS.com - Finance Minister Purbaya Yudhi Sadewa has admitted to communicating directly with Director General of Customs Djaka Budi Utama regarding the emergence of Djaka’s name in the indictment of an alleged bribery case for import permit facilitation that ensnares Blueray Cargo Group leader, John Field.

Purbaya said that Djaka stated he would follow the entire ongoing legal process. However, Djaka’s legal status so far remains limited to being mentioned in the indictment, with no further determination yet.

“I have (communicated). He (Director General Djaka) will follow the applicable legal process. This isn’t anything yet, it’s still new,” Purbaya told reporters at the Ministry of Finance, Jakarta, on Thursday (6/5/2026).

“No (deactivation). Not until it’s clear what’s going on there. The process is just starting. The name just appeared, why stop immediately,” he said.

According to Purbaya, administrative steps will only be decided after the case has legal clarity.

He also assured that the ministry will provide legal assistance if needed, as done for other officials facing legal processes.

However, Purbaya emphasised that such assistance is not a form of intervention in law enforcement.

“There will be if called and so on. Others also have assistance. Not intervention,” he said.

The public prosecutor read the indictment against three defendants, namely John Field, Dedy Kurniawan Sukolo as Operational Manager of Customs Clearance at the Port, and Andri as Head of the Import Documents Team.

The indictment states that in July 2025, a meeting took place at Hotel Borobudur attended by several customs officials and cargo entrepreneurs.
